Cognitive Load Theory and Its Relevance to User Engagement
Cognitive Load Theory (CLT), introduced by John Sweller in the late 1980s, emphasizes that human working memory has limited capacity. Excessive information or overly complex interactions can hinder learning and diminish user satisfaction. Effective digital design, therefore, must focus on minimizing unnecessary cognitive demands while facilitating meaningful interactions.
A practical approach involves breaking down complex tasks into manageable segments, employing visual cues, and reducing friction points. Gaming and simulation platforms have successfully applied CLT principles, leading to more intuitive user experiences and higher retention rates.
